This Proto-Germanic entry contains reconstructed terms and roots. As such, the term(s) in this entry are not directly attested, but are hypothesized to have existed based on comparative evidence.

Proto-Germanic[edit]

Etymology[edit]

From Proto-Indo-European *sperdʰ- (contest).

Pronunciation[edit]

  • IPA(key): /ˈspurdz/, /ˈspurðz/

Noun[edit]

*spurdz f

  1. racecourse; racetrack
